Kanji 嚙

To favorites
Radical: (30)
Strokes: 18
On:
コウ、ゴウ
kou, gou
Kun:
か.む、か.じる
ka.mu, ka.jiru
Reading in names:
-
Meanings:
bite, gnaw

Examples

噛む
かむ
kamu
to bite; to chew;to gnaw;to masticate; to fumble one's words (esp. during a play, broadcast, etc.);to falter with one's words;to stutter;to stammer; to crash against (e.g. of waves);to break onto (shore); to engage (of cogs, zippers, etc.);to mesh;to fit together; to be involved in; to convince;to persuade
жевать; кусать; 1) кусать; грызть; 2) жевать; 3) (тех.) быть (находиться) в зацеплении, зацепляться
歯噛み
はがみ
hagami
grinding of the teeth;involuntary nocturnal tooth grinding;bruxism; grinding one's teeth out of anger or vexation;gnashing one's teeth;gritting one's teeth
